A brief introduction about Stealin’ Christmas. It is a top down shooter and tells the story of how the Grinch started obsessing over stealing Christmas every year after being bullied constantly by Santa Claus when they were still in school. The player will control the Grinch in the game.

Enemies are based on old-school toys like the monkeys from ‘Barrel of Monkeys’. I had plans for those hippos from ‘Hungry Hippos’ but had to cut them due to time constraint. When defeated, the enemies will shrink back to their toy form and explode like fireworks.
